Robust entanglement in atomic systems via Λ-type processes

Description
It is shown that the system of two three-level atoms in the Λ configuration in a cavity can evolve into a long-lived maximum entangled state if the Stokes photons vanish from the cavity by means of either leakage or damping. The difference in the evolution picture corresponding to the general model and effective model with two-photon process in a two-level system is discussed
